Abstract
The utility model discloses one kind to overturn cleaning device,Including frame,The top surface of frame is anterior to be provided with product input roller,The top surface rear portion of frame is provided with output of products roller,Switching mechanism is provided between output of products roller and product input roller,Switching mechanism includes resupination framework,The top surface of resupination framework is provided with transmission belt,Docked with product input roller one end of transmission belt,The other end of transmission belt docks with output of products roller,The position that transmission belt is corresponded on resupination framework is provided with compression cylinder,Product compact heap moving up and down is installed on the telescopic end of compression cylinder,Upset motor is installed on the bottom surface of resupination framework,The rotating shaft of upset motor is fixedly mounted in frame,The position that bottom of the frame corresponds to below switching mechanism is provided with horizontally movable cleaning mechanism,Cleaning mechanism includes the slide bar being arranged in bottom of the frame,Sliding block is slidably fitted with slide bar,Cleaning shower nozzle is installed on sliding block,Shower nozzle is cleaned to arrange towards switching mechanism.Suitable for the cleaning of product.

Product is transported on switching mechanism 4 and compressed by product input roller 2 first, then with cleaning mechanism 5 to production
The bottom surface of product is cleaned, treat product bottom surface cleaning after, then by switching mechanism 4 by product overturn 180 °, then again
The top surface of product is cleaned with cleaning mechanism 5, after all cleaning, resets switching mechanism 4 and product compact heap 4d successively,
Transmission belt 4b is finally passed sequentially through again and output of products roller 3 transfers out product, simple to operate and efficiency high.
Above-mentioned resupination framework 4a reverses direction and the transmission direction of the transmission belt 4b are arranged vertically.By by turning frame
Frame 4a reverses direction and transmission belt 4b transmission direction are designed to be arranged vertically, can so be effectively prevented from switching mechanism 4 with
Interfered between output of products roller 3 and product input roller 2, while be also convenient for postorder resupination framework 4a upset position limiting structure
Design.
An above-mentioned resupination framework 4a side is provided with upset baffle plate 4f in place.Baffle plate 4f can ensure that in place for the upset added
Resupination framework 4a overturns 180 ° exactly.The frame 1, which is provided with, to be used to detect whether the resupination framework 4a overturns in place
Photoelectric sensor 6.The photoelectric sensor 6 added realizes the automation of the present apparatus.Specifically, when photoelectric sensor 6 detects
After the resupination framework 4a upsets in place, i.e., stopping signal is sent to controller, controller just controls upset motor 4e to shut down.
Above-mentioned upset motor 4e rotating shaft is fixedly mounted in the frame 1 by turning supporting seat 4g.Above-mentioned cleaning mechanism 5
Move horizontally and can be driven by motor, will not be repeated here.
